 When you find a dead moon jelly on the beach, you may see a blob that is 2540 cm (1016 in) wide, and includes the four horseshoe shaped gonads That would represent a fairly intact adult moon jelly As it becomes more and more degraded by wave action and decay, all that's left is the tougher center of the mesoglea disk, which might be as little as 7 cm (25 in) What Does a Jellyfish Birds and crabs and other scavengers on the beach will eat up those jellies in no time One of South Carolina's favorite marine animals — the sea turtle — loves to snack on jellyfish Moon jellyfish (Aurelia aurita) are found in nearly all the world's oceans, primarily in inshore regions like harbors and estuaries Because its locomotion is rather limited, this species prefers temperate waters with regular currents that can help push it through the water column The moon jelly feeds on plankton using the tentacles flowing from the bell, and is not harmful to

Moon jellyfish's stinging cells are relatively benign to us In some cases a person may experience some mild stinging sensation if stung The discomfort is fairly localized and does not persist for a long period of time The disks you see on the beach usually have few if any tentacles remaining attached hence there are no stinging nematocysts present A moon snail (image courtesy of SReynolds) Jelly sacks are not jellyfish Instead they are an egg mass laid by moon snails The eggs are encased in the clear, moonshaped, jellylike substance So when you are squishing them between your toes remember you are actually squishing tiny moon snails 2 Sponge This little guy is often mistaken for a plant, but is actuallyMoon Jellyfish These are the most common jellyfish around the coasts of Wales, and have only a mild sting They can be identified by the four pink or purple rings and can reach up to a foot in diameter Found at Porth Dynion Barrel Jellyfish These can be up to 3 feet across, and only have a very mild sting They are not a danger to swimmers, even if washed ashore in their thousands
